Your decision to become a part of the Beaufort County Adult Community Education Program is one that will change your life. I strongly believe this may be the most important step for you to reach your goals and dreams for the future.
When you step into our classroom, virtually or in person, enter with an open mind and meet every challenge presented. You are entering school as an adult, bringing with you knowledge from previous schooling. Those experiences alone will assist you in navigating the Adult Education component.
Let’s join forces and make this educational experience beneficial to you and your future.
